Qwen2.5-3B-Instruct: CHPE Contiguous Raw Weights (ARM Neoverse-N1)
This repository contains the zero-overhead, strictly aligned raw weight archives for Qwen2.5-3B-Instruct, formatted specifically for the Christopher Hamil Prediction Engine (CHPE) on 64-bit ARM microarchitectures.
Key Performance Results (ARM Neoverse-N1 @ 3.00 GHz, 16 vCPUs)
| Architecture | Model | Precision | Token Latency | Generation Speed | Delta vs Llama.cpp | Verification |
|---|---|---|---|---|---|---|
| CHPE (Hamil) | Qwen2.5-3B-Instruct | FP16 | $106.25\text{ ms}$ | $9.138\text{ tok/s}$ | $-16.57%$ | argmax=50994, 0 NaN/Inf |
| CHPE (Hamil) | Qwen2.5-3B-Instruct | BF16 | $126.94\text{ ms}$ | $7.810\text{ tok/s}$ | $-0.32%$ | argmax=50994, 0 NaN/Inf |
| Llama.cpp | Qwen2.5-3B-Instruct | Full FP | $127.35\text{ ms}$ | $7.785\text{ tok/s}$ | Baseline ($0.0%$) | Benchmark ref |

File Manifest & Checksums
All archives are raw binary memory-mappable blocks aligned to $16,384\text{ bytes}$ ($256 \times 64\text{B}$ cache lines):
Qwen2.5-3B-Instruct.fp16.raw.chpe: $6,174,363,648\text{ bytes}$ (IEEE 754 half-precision float)Qwen2.5-3B-Instruct.bf16.raw.chpe: $6,174,363,648\text{ bytes}$ (Brain Floating Point 16-bit)tokenizer.json: Fast HF Tokenizer definition for Qwen2.5 vocabulary ($151,936\text{ tokens}$)manifest.json: Structural tensor offsets and streaming SHA256 signatures
